WORLD HEPATITIS DAY 2020 IN AFRICA About hepatitis and the World Hepatitis Alliance in the WHO AFRO region. In Africa, chronic viral hepatitis affects more than 80 million people (73.6 million with hepatitis B and 9.6 million with hepatitis C 1).Fewer than 1 in 10 people in Africa have access to testing and treatment 2, and coverage of the hepatitis B birth dose vaccine is lower than in any other region in the world 1. Almost 10 million people are affected by chronic viral hepatitis in the Americas, with 4.4 million people living with hepatitis B and 5.4 million living with hepatitis C 1.More than 44,000 people die as a result of viral hepatitis or related complications in the region each year 1. WORLD HEPATITIS DAY IN THE WESTERN PACIFIC About hepatitis and the World Hepatitis Alliance in the WHO WPRO region. The Western Pacific accounts for 40 per cent of all chronic viral hepatitis cases worldwide 1, with 109 million people living with hepatitis B and 13.8 million with hepatitis C 2.More than half a million people die as a result of viral hepatitis or related complications in the region each year 2. WHAT IS WORLD HEPATITIS DAY? World Hepatitis Day (WHD) takes places every year on 28 July bringing the world together under a single theme to raise awareness of the global burden of viral hepatitis and to influence real change. In 2020 the theme is ‘Find the Missing Millions’. Worldwide, 290 million people are living with viral hepatitis unaware. Without finding the undiagnosed and linking them to care, millions will continue to suffer, and lives will be lost. On World Hepatitis Day, 28 July, we call on people from across the world to take action and raise awareness to find the “missing millions”. > WHD is a day for the world’s hepatitis community to unite and make > our voices heard. It’s a day to celebrate the progress we have > made and to meet the current challenges. It’s also an opportunity > for us to increase awareness and encourage a real political change > to jointly facilitate prevention, diagnosis and treatment. > WHD is a great opportunity for us to raise awareness of the > importance of knowing your hepatitis status and to spread the word > about treatment.
